Just on concept alone, I'm drawn to Elementalist. Maybe I've watched a little too much Avatar: The Last Airbender, but there is just something primal and cool about bending Earth, Fire, Air, and Water to your will.

If they made Avatar: The Last Airbender Miniatures I would be using them  :-*

As far as Frostgrave is concerned, I was initially turned off by their spell selection. The casting numbers are high and the spell selection is mostly damage based. Shoot that guy over there. Shoot a few guys over there. Burn everyone near you. Make that sword flaming so it does more damage, etc...

In the current campaign I'm playing in I switched to an Elementalist, after my Illusionist died horribly, and I'm living the Avatar dream. Leaping about, creating walls of stone, pushing stuff around with air blasts, and scorching  things with fire on occasion.
